Dhaneta
Dhaneta is a village located in Nadaun tehsil of Hamirpur district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 24km away from district headquarter Nadaun. Nadaun is the sub-district headquarter of Dhaneta village. As per 2009 stats, Dhaneta village is also a gram panchayat.

About Dhaneta
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dhaneta is 016610. The village spans a total geographical area of 47.31 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 177041. Nadaun is nearest town to Dhaneta village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Dhaneta village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Nadaun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Dhaneta
Below is a concise population overview of Dhaneta as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 484 | 249 | 235 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 36 | 20 | 16 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 156 | 80 | 76 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 413 | 221 | 192 |
Illiterate Population | 71 | 28 | 43 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dhaneta village:
- The total population of Dhaneta village is around 484, including approximately 249 males and 235 females, with a sex ratio of 943 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 36 children aged 0–6 years in Dhaneta village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Dhaneta village has 156 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Dhaneta village is about 85.33%, with male literacy at 88.76% and female literacy at 81.70%.
- There are around 103 households in Dhaneta village.
Connectivity of Dhaneta
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dhaneta. As per the 2011 stats, Dhaneta had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
